A new bridge is being constructed in Manglisi
06 January, 2017 00:00:00

By order of Roads Department of the Ministry of Regional Development and Infrastructure of Georgia, construction works of a new bridge crossing are underway at km 29 of Tbilisi (Pantiani) – Manglisi secondary road instead of the existing stone arch bridge crossing.

The bridge is located in the Tetritskaro Municipality, namely, at the crossing of Unnamed Stream in a small town Manglisi. After putting the bridge into use, tourists and guests in the resort area of Manglisi will be able to move safely and comfortably.   

The project envisages: construction of the new reinforced concrete arch bridge with a single span; arrangement works of the bridge carriageway, shoulders, junctions with local roads, road signs and encircling; horizontal marking on the bridge carriageway will be carried out. At the moment, the arrangement works of piles are underway.

Deputy Chairman of Roads Department of Georgia Givi Chochia has inspected ongoing works.

The project is being financed by the state budget and its cost is GEL 1 832 900. Works started in August 2016 and will be completed in October 2017.
